What This Means: The Evolution of Pokémon Go

The recent 10th anniversary celebration of Pokémon Go in Times Square marked a pivotal moment for the game, illustrating how far the technology has come since its initial launch. Almost 2,000 players, including prominent influencers, gathered to engage in a live battle against a Mega Evolved Mewtwo. This not only reflects the game’s enduring appeal but also sets a benchmark for how augmented reality can unite communities in real-time.

Key Facts and Context

  • Pokémon Go launched in July 2016, quickly becoming a cultural phenomenon.
  • The game has consistently innovated with new features, such as augmented reality battles.
  • Nearly 2,000 players participated in the recent anniversary event in Times Square.
  • Mewtwo, a highly sought-after Pokémon, was the central figure in the live event.
